    Sir Paul McCartney Praises Duffy's Cover Of Wings' Classic

    Sir Paul McCartney has praised Duffy's cover of The Wings' track 'Live and Let Die', which appears on a new War Child album.

    Duffy is one of a host of current chart stars who were picked by legendary musicians for the album, entitled 'Heroes'.

    Beck was nominated by Bob Dylan to cover 'Leopard-Skin Pill-Box Hat', while The Kinks' 'Victoria' has been re-imagined by The Kooks.

    Sir Paul, who recorded 'Live and Let Die' for the James Bond film of the same name, called Duffy's cover “great”, adding: “The breadth of talent on this project is amazing.

    It’s great that so many people have given their time, energy and support to this initiative. I urge everyone to support War Child.”

    'Heroes' is due to be released on November 24th.
